AI Summary
-
Adds a new death benefit provision providing one year of health insurance coverage for surviving spouses, widows, widowers, and children of police officers, firefighters, and emergency medical technicians who die from work-related injuries.
-
Health insurance coverage must be the same or substantially the same as the employer-provided insurance the deceased had at the time of death, beginning the day after death or when employer coverage terminates, whichever is later.
-
Defines "emergency medical technician" to include volunteer EMTs and employees certified under AS 18.08 employed to provide emergency medical services.
-
Defines "firefighter" to include municipal fire department employees, volunteer firefighters, and those registered with the state fire marshal.
-
Defines "police officer" to include state and municipal police employees with arrest authority, airport police officers, University of Alaska public safety officers, and volunteer police officers.
